The braking force generated in this manner is modulated by
solenoid valves "11" and "12".
During this phase the maximum pressure is limited by the
drive solenoid valves "6" and cannot exceed 90 bar.
The driver is informed of the cutting in of this system by the
flashing of the corresponding warning light on the
dashboard.
If the warning light turns on and glows steadily, there is an
ABD system failure.

This component integrates both the electronic part and the
electrohydraulic system control modulator.
It comprises the following:
A - Electronic control unit
B - Electrohydraulic modulator
C - Accumulator
It is connected to the hydraulic system by the following
connections:
F - Front axle supply
R - Rear axle supply
LF - Left front axle output
RF - Right front axle output
LR - Left rear axle output
RR - Right rear axle output
It is connected to the electric system through a 31-pin
connector.
